[QUOTE="robinjojo, post: 4542972, member: 110226"]It looks like a Guatemala cob that has been around the block innumerable times. The hole was probably there for a considerable amount of time. Many of the indigenous people in the region lacked pockets, so the coins were holed to accommodate being held on a string. This was a very wide spread practice. Later, someone inserted a ring into the hole. I'm pretty sure the coin is genuine. The date appears to be 1739.[/QUOTE]
